Unless you are a top notch shooter, full choke at 16 yards would be a handicap. A mod choke would be more than enough. Many good doubles shooters use even a IC choke on the first barrel and a IM or full on the second. The really good shooters like a full choke so they see a " dust ball " so if they get a little off they can tell where to correct it. That dust ball doesn't leave much room for error. As suggested, go to station 3 and with just straight a-ways see what sight picture you need to break the targets. You'll probably need some padding to see the bird when it breaks. Good luck.
